#b4d97d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b4d97d is composed of 70.6% red, 85.1% green and 49%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 17.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 42.4% yellow and 14.9% black. It has a hue angle of 84.1 degrees, a saturation of 54.8% and a lightness of 67.1%. #b4d97d color hex could be obtained by blending #fffffa with #69b300. Closest websafe color is: #cccc66.

#b4d97d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b4d97d has RGB values of R:180, G:217, B:125 and CMYK values of C:0.17, M:0, Y:0.42,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 11852157.

Shades and Tints of #b4d97d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050702 is the darkest color, while #fafcf6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#b4d97d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#abacaa is the less saturated color, while #baf95d is the most saturated one.
